Common operational challenges in multi-store retail environments
Retail organizations usually recognize the symptoms before they identify the root cause. Store managers may report stockouts despite healthy central inventory. Finance teams may spend days reconciling sales, returns, and intercompany transfers. Merchandising teams may lack confidence in sell-through data because product attributes, units of measure, and category structures differ by location. Regional leaders may receive performance reports that are technically complete but operationally misleading because store execution standards are inconsistent.
- Different stores follow different receiving, transfer, return, and cycle count procedures, creating inconsistent inventory records.
- Point-of-sale, purchasing, warehouse, and accounting systems are poorly integrated, reducing reporting quality and slowing period close.
- Promotions, markdowns, and replenishment decisions are managed locally without enterprise controls or auditability.
- Store labor planning and task execution are disconnected from actual sales, inventory, and service demand.
- Master data such as products, vendors, pricing rules, and chart of accounts are not governed centrally.
- Executives lack near-real-time operational visibility across stores, channels, and legal entities.
These issues are not only technical. They are governance and operating model problems. A retailer can deploy enterprise ERP software and still fail to improve reporting quality if workflows remain optional, data ownership is unclear, and exception handling is unmanaged. ERP modernization therefore must combine platform standardization with process discipline.
How Odoo ERP supports retail workflow standardization
Odoo ERP provides a practical architecture for retail standardization because it connects commercial, operational, and financial workflows in a single platform. Retailers can use CRM and Sales to manage customer interactions and commercial activity, Purchase and Inventory to standardize replenishment and stock movement, Accounting to improve financial control, Project to manage rollout initiatives, Helpdesk to support store issue resolution, HR and Planning to align workforce execution, Documents to govern operational records, and Quality and Maintenance to improve store and equipment reliability. For retailers with light assembly, packaging, or private-label operations, Manufacturing can also support standardized production and replenishment processes.
The value of Odoo ERP in retail is not limited to module breadth. Its real advantage is the ability to define controlled workflows that connect transactions end to end. A purchase order can trigger receiving, quality checks, inventory updates, vendor bill processing, and accounting entries under a governed process. A store transfer can be approved, tracked, received, and reconciled consistently across locations. A customer return can follow a standard path from store intake to stock disposition and financial treatment. This level of workflow automation improves both store execution and enterprise reporting quality.

Designing a standard retail operating model before ERP implementation
A successful ERP implementation starts with operating model design, not software configuration. Retailers should define which processes must be standardized enterprise-wide, which can vary by region, and which require controlled exceptions. Core candidates for standardization include item master governance, vendor onboarding, purchase approvals, receiving, stock transfers, cycle counts, markdown approvals, returns handling, cash and payment reconciliation, store issue escalation, and period-end close procedures.
SysGenPro should guide retailers to establish process ownership across business functions before configuration begins. Finance should own accounting policy and reporting structures. Supply chain should own replenishment and transfer rules. Retail operations should own store execution standards. HR should own workforce and role design. IT and ERP governance teams should own security, integration standards, and release management. This governance structure reduces the risk of implementing Odoo ERP as a collection of departmental preferences rather than an enterprise platform.
Workflow optimization recommendations for store execution
Improving store execution requires more than digitizing existing tasks. Retailers should redesign workflows to reduce ambiguity at the store level and increase exception visibility at the enterprise level. Receiving should use standardized validation steps, barcode-driven confirmation where appropriate, and automated discrepancy routing. Replenishment should be based on governed rules rather than ad hoc store requests. Transfers should require clear source and destination accountability. Returns should follow predefined disposition logic to protect inventory accuracy and margin reporting.
Odoo Inventory, Purchase, Sales, Documents, Quality, and Helpdesk can work together to support this model. For example, a store receiving discrepancy can automatically create a documented exception, notify the responsible team, and route the issue for resolution. A recurring stock variance can trigger a quality review or targeted retraining. A store maintenance issue can be logged through Helpdesk and scheduled through Maintenance and Planning, reducing downtime and improving customer experience.
Improving enterprise reporting quality through data and control standardization
Enterprise reporting quality depends on standardized data structures and transaction discipline. Retailers should harmonize product hierarchies, location structures, units of measure, pricing logic, supplier records, chart of accounts, tax rules, and approval paths. Without this foundation, dashboards may look sophisticated while still producing inconsistent or misleading outputs. Odoo ERP supports stronger reporting quality when master data governance is treated as a formal workstream during ERP modernization.
A realistic scenario illustrates the issue. A retailer with 60 stores may report healthy inventory availability at the enterprise level, yet several stores continue to miss sales because transfer receipts are delayed, damaged goods are not dispositioned consistently, and local teams use nonstandard product substitutions. Once Odoo ERP standardizes transfer workflows, receiving controls, quality checks, and accounting treatment, the same retailer can produce more reliable stock, shrink, margin, and store productivity reporting. Better reporting quality is therefore a direct result of better process execution.
Cloud ERP considerations for distributed retail operations
Cloud ERP is especially relevant for retail because stores are geographically distributed and require consistent access to current processes, data, and controls. A cloud deployment model reduces the burden of maintaining local infrastructure, supports faster rollout to new stores, and simplifies centralized administration. However, cloud ERP decisions should still account for network resilience, role-based access, integration architecture, backup policies, and support operating models. Retailers should also define how store operations continue during connectivity disruptions and how transactions are synchronized once service is restored.
For Odoo hosting, retailers should evaluate environment segregation, performance management during peak periods, security controls, monitoring, disaster recovery, and release governance. Automation opportunities that create measurable retail value
- Automated replenishment rules based on sales velocity, safety stock, lead times, and seasonality.
- Automated approval routing for purchases, markdowns, stock adjustments, and vendor exceptions.
- Automated creation of accounting entries from inventory, purchasing, and sales transactions to improve close quality.
- Automated store issue ticketing and escalation through Helpdesk for operational disruptions.
- Automated preventive maintenance scheduling for store equipment and facilities.
- Automated document capture and retention for receiving records, vendor documents, and compliance evidence.
Automation should be introduced selectively. Retailers should first automate high-volume, high-variance, and control-sensitive workflows. Over-automation of unstable processes can amplify errors. A practical implementation sequence is to stabilize master data, standardize core workflows, establish reporting baselines, and then expand automation in replenishment, approvals, exception management, and maintenance.
Implementation guidance for a phased retail ERP rollout
A phased ERP implementation is usually more effective than a broad retail transformation launched all at once. Phase one should focus on foundational controls: master data, purchasing, inventory, accounting, and core reporting. Phase two can extend into store issue management, workforce planning, document governance, and quality controls. Phase three can optimize advanced automation, multi-company reporting, maintenance, and continuous improvement analytics. Project should be used to manage rollout milestones, dependencies, testing, and training readiness.
Pilot design is critical. Retailers should select pilot stores that represent operational complexity rather than only choosing the easiest locations. A useful pilot includes at least one high-volume store, one average-performing store, and one location with known process challenges. This approach exposes workflow weaknesses early and improves enterprise rollout quality. Success criteria should include inventory accuracy, receiving compliance, transfer turnaround, close cycle improvement, issue resolution time, and reporting consistency.

Change management considerations for store adoption
Store teams adopt standardized ERP workflows when the system reduces ambiguity and makes daily execution easier. Change management should therefore focus on role-based training, clear SOPs, local champion networks, and visible issue resolution during rollout. Retailers should avoid training that explains screens without explaining operational intent. Store managers need to understand why receiving discipline affects replenishment quality, why transfer confirmation affects enterprise reporting, and why documented exceptions matter for auditability and margin control.
Leadership should also monitor adoption metrics, not just technical go-live status. Examples include percentage of transactions following standard workflow, unresolved exception volume, cycle count compliance, approval turnaround time, and store-level data quality trends. These indicators reveal whether ERP modernization is changing behavior or merely changing software.
